The OMV Kronos Citroen World Rally Team will try a new attack on a top-8-place at the “Rally d’Italia Sardegna”. For only then the the commitment in the FIA World Rally Championship is justified. But scoring points is getting more and more difficult this season for Manfred Stohl/Ilka Minor (Austria) and their Swedish-French teammates Daniel Carlsson/Denis Giraudet. The difference between works and private cars is too big.
Statistics speak a plain language
Manfred Stohl has accepted the status quo following eighth place in Argentina. Stohl: “If both drivers of the works teams reach the finish seventh place is the limit. “ And the OMV driver has the statistics to prove it. While last year privateers had finished 14 times among the top-6 and reached three podium places after six runs they only have eight top-6-places and one podium place to their account in 2007. Stohl: “That clearly show the status quo. But we are nevertheless still motivated. We are working very hard to increase our performance. Which means that we obviously want to reach the top-8 in Sardinia, as well. “
